Why this matters in Port St. Lucie
Port St. Lucie is a young, fast-grown city built largely on slab-on-grade construction from the 1990s onward, laced with one of the most extensive freshwater canal networks in the country. That high water table, near-constant humidity, and heavy year-round air-conditioning keep condensation and hidden-moisture risk elevated even in newer homes. A single clogged HVAC condensate line or a slow slab-edge leak can sustain growth long before anyone sees a stain.
